A small pedal boat was found drifting down the Columbia River on Thursday morning.

The white boat was pulled from the river by the Pasco Fire and Rescue boat and tied off at the Pasco Boat Basin.

Fire officials speculated the small recreational craft recently slid into the water and floated away.

No one was in the boat and how it got into the river was not known.
